About the game

What you do in a play session

In Undaunted: Normandy, you are transported to the summer of 1944, just after D-Day, where Allied forces have established a foothold in Normandy. Your objective? Lead your troops deeper into France, pushing back the German forces. But don't expect a walk in the park: resistance will be fierce, with machine gun fire and mortar bombardments raining down. The key is to be a cunning commander, turning every challenging situation into a strategic advantage.

This is a deck-building game for two players, where you take command of American or German forces in a series of missions critical to the outcome of World War II. Your cards are your primary tool: use them to seize the initiative, bolster your units, or control your soldiers on the battlefield. Strong leadership can turn the tide of battle in your favor, but reckless decisions could prove catastrophic, as every casualty removes a card from your deck, weakening your options. There are 12 different scenarios, each with unique terrain configurations and troops, and you can even link them into a campaign, where the results of one battle influence the next. Frequently Asked Questions

Quick answers before you buy

6 questions
How many players can play Undaunted: Normandy?
Undaunted: Normandy is exclusively a two-player game, making it perfect for strategic duels.
What is the average game length?
A game typically lasts between 45 and 60 minutes, ideal for those seeking a tactical experience without it being overly long.
What is the complexity level of the game?
With a BGG weight of 2.27/5, it's a medium-complexity game. It's not overly difficult, but it offers strategic depth for players who enjoy thoughtful gameplay.
Does the game have many components?
Yes, it comes with 108 cards, 18 large modular map tiles, 4 D10 dice, various tokens, and two booklets (rules and campaign). All high-quality for an immersive war experience!

What makes Undaunted: Normandy different from other wargames?
It cleverly combines the tactical tension of a wargame with the deck-building mechanic. Every casualty in your platoon removes cards from your deck, which is a brutally elegant and thematic mechanic!
